Chan Canasta Live on Television March 18th 1960Chan CanastaThe download DVD is a complete Chan Canasta television broadcast from a 1960's BBC TV Show. You see a professional entertainer perform, how he controls his spectators, and how he builds up the effects. Chan first performs a few card effects and closes with a book test. In the beginning spectators take a few cards each and Canasta divines which cards each one has. Then two spectators take one card from a full deck each and they magically take the same card. Nothing Is As It SeemsCameron FrancisThe magician shows a packet of four cards, say three blue-backed Three of Hearts and one red-backed Joker. The Joker is placed in the magician's pocket but keeps jumping back into the packet several times. For the final kicker, all of the cards turn blank. Totally examinable. Easy to do. Requires four blank faced cards. | ★★★★★ $10 to wish listMP4 (video) | |

Twist and WaltzAldo ColombiniEffect created by Raphael Czaja. A novel piece of magic which will bring you a new 'twist' on a classic theme! Four cards are selected and placed on the table. You show four face-down cards and one at a time one card turns over and it reveals one of the selected cards. At the end, each chosen card is revealed. Then you reveal that the four cards have backs on both sides! Requires three double-backed cards and two double-faced cards. | $10 to wish listMP4 (video) |
